#10 Day Day Victory gets back to his preferred course and trip after finding Sha Tin unsuitable last start. While he’s yet to win in Class 4, his close second over this track and distance two runs back puts him in the mix in an open race. #1 Lean Master sets the benchmark off his recent win, but has never strung back-to-back wins together and the stable has a similar trend, which casts some doubt. #2 Happy United was runner-up to Lean Master two back and that form holds up. #9 Happy Boys is only a three-year-old and comes off a career-best third to Candlelight Dinner over this course and trip—he’s on the up.

Neurals

These are computer enhanced analyses of all the areas which go into making up a race field. They factor in algorithms for every contingency as explained below and added them up to generate the likely best horse in a race.

When you go into them via the Form Guide page you simply run your mouse over any column and you can sort the field by any individual type of Neural Rating which determines the final total (and therefore best rater).

Explanation of Inputs for Neural Analysis

CP Career performance assessment based on weight/class algorithms
CF Current form measured by class/weight algorithms
TIM Revolutionary time assessment (adjusted algorithm)
JA Jockey ability algorithm
TA Trainer ability algorithm
JT Jockey/trainer combination algorithm
WT Wet track performance algorithm
Crs Course suitability algorithm
D Distance suitability algorithm
$ Prizemoney earned algorithm
BP Barrier position (course & distance) algorithm
DLR Days since last run algorithm
  • The user sets the level of importance from the Preference Scale (1 to 5 or No) for each algorithm and the output weightings are listed within seconds.
  • The Neural factor analysis will quickly identify for you just who are the main chances in each race, the highest to the lowest based on the factor weightings
